This is a 2-story single-family residence in the Colonial Revival style built in 1924. The building is rectangular in plan. The structural system is masonry. The foundation is poured concrete. Exterior walls are original brick. The building has a side gable roof clad in original concrete tiles. There is one side right, exterior, brick chimney. Windows are original wood, 6/1 double-hung sashes. There is a partial-width platform/stoop. Concrete half-round stoop with historic metal railings. Primary facade and entrance face Augusta Street. There is a single-story, side, frame addition.
* Date source: Village of Oak Park building permit archives.
